The Scottish FA Cup was played for the 37th time in 1909/10 . The most important Scottish football cup competition, which was directed and hosted by the Scottish Football Association, began on January 15, 1910 and ended with the 2nd repeat final on April 20, 1910 in Ibrox Park in Glasgow . After the riots last year , no club started as defending champions in the competition. In this year's Scottish Cup final, FC Dundee and FC Clyde faced each other. For both clubs it was the first final participation in the club's history. After a 2: 2 in the first final game, the repeat final ended 0: 0 after extra time . In the second replay final, FC Dundee prevailed 2-1 and won the Scottish FA Cup for the first time . At the event this season, due to the tight schedule and numerous weather-related cancellations, there were some overlaps between the respective rounds and its repetitions. In the final table of Scottish Division One , the two clubs finished fifth and sixth, champion was for the sixth time as a result of Celtic Glasgow .
